Any suggestions for dining out for lunch in Owings Mills. MD?

There were two very helpful responses.

There is a Red Robin in the area.
The Artful Gourmet Bistro. It is a nice casual kind of place but classy.
http://www.artfulgourmet.com/
Mike was my waiter who knew a lot about gluten free stuff. His girlfriend 
is celiac and/or her son is autistic, so he knows all about gluten free, 
and had the kitchen do me a whole gluten free dish and oversaw it to 
prevent any contamination.  I think Mike is also the owner, so you may 
want to call ahead and talk to one of them.

Noodles and company has a GF option in addition to Qdoba which is in the 
same shopping center.  It is right next to the Best Buy. There is also 
the Flying Avocado which is off of Painters Mill that has gluten free 
bread and options.
